文件名称:has:Dojo 2-功能检测库
文件大小:106KB
文件格式:ZIP
更新时间:2024-05-17 19:55:42
TypeScript
@dojo/has存储库已被弃用并合并到 您可以在我们的上阅读有关此更改的更多信息。 我们将继续为has和其他Dojo 2存储库提供补丁,并且可用于帮助将项目从v2迁移到v3。 @ dojo /有 功能检测库。 该软件包提供了一个用于表达功能检测的API,以允许开发人员根据检测到的功能来分支代码。 这些功能也可以静态声明,从而允许集成到构建优化工具中,该工具可用于创建“死”代码分支,这些分支可以在构建步骤中消除。 has模块还能够允许使用某些装载机有条件地装载模块。 用法 要使用@dojo/has ,只需安装软件包: npm install @dojo/has 并将其导入到您的应用程序中, import has from '@dojo/has' ; if ( has ( 'some-feature' ) ) { /* use some feature */ } 特征 功能
【文件预览】:
has-master
----.gitignore(193B)
----codecov.yml(346B)
----package.json(1KB)
----tslint.json(2KB)
----package-lock.json(359KB)
----src()
--------loader.ts(1KB)
--------main.ts(68B)
--------has.ts(7KB)
----.travis.yml(2KB)
----CONTRIBUTING.md(195B)
----Gruntfile.js(302B)
----LICENSE(2KB)
----tsconfig.json(444B)
----.github()
--------PULL_REQUEST_TEMPLATE.md(514B)
--------ISSUE_TEMPLATE.md(657B)
--------CONTRIBUTING.md(343B)
----README.md(9KB)
----tests()
--------unit()
--------support()
--------run.html(251B)
--------functional()
----intern.json(2KB)
----.gitattributes(406B)
----docs()
--------api.json(83KB)
----deploy_key.enc(3KB)
----.editorconfig(279B)